Final Scottish Division Two 1993/1994 league table
Season completed Saturday, 14th May 1994 (click column headings to re-sort)
| Home | Away | Overall | |||||||||||||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| # | Team | Pl | W | D | L | F | A | W | D | L | F | A | W | D | L | F | A | Pts | GD |
| 1 | Stranraer | 39 | 15 | 2 | 3 | 38 | 18 | 8 | 8 | 3 | 25 | 17 | 23 | 10 | 6 | 63 | 35 | 56 | +28 |
| 2 | Berwick Rangers | 39 | 9 | 7 | 4 | 40 | 23 | 9 | 5 | 5 | 35 | 23 | 18 | 12 | 9 | 75 | 46 | 48 | +29 |
| 3 | Stenhousemuir | 39 | 10 | 6 | 3 | 35 | 15 | 9 | 3 | 8 | 27 | 29 | 19 | 9 | 11 | 62 | 44 | 47 | +18 |
| 4 | Meadowbank Thistle | 39 | 9 | 8 | 2 | 36 | 24 | 8 | 5 | 7 | 26 | 24 | 17 | 13 | 9 | 62 | 48 | 47 | +14 |
| 5 | Queen of the South | 39 | 9 | 3 | 7 | 36 | 20 | 8 | 6 | 6 | 33 | 28 | 17 | 9 | 13 | 69 | 48 | 43 | +21 |
| 6 | East Fife | 39 | 9 | 5 | 5 | 33 | 23 | 6 | 6 | 8 | 25 | 29 | 15 | 11 | 13 | 58 | 52 | 41 | +6 |
| 7 | Alloa Athletic | 39 | 6 | 8 | 6 | 16 | 17 | 6 | 9 | 4 | 25 | 22 | 12 | 17 | 10 | 41 | 39 | 41 | +2 |
| 8 | Forfar Athletic | 39 | 6 | 6 | 8 | 27 | 32 | 8 | 5 | 6 | 31 | 26 | 14 | 11 | 14 | 58 | 58 | 39 | 0 |
| 9 | East Stirlingshire | 39 | 7 | 3 | 9 | 29 | 31 | 6 | 8 | 6 | 25 | 26 | 13 | 11 | 15 | 54 | 57 | 37 | -3 |
| 10 | Montrose | 39 | 6 | 5 | 8 | 24 | 25 | 8 | 3 | 9 | 32 | 36 | 14 | 8 | 17 | 56 | 61 | 36 | -5 |
| 11 | Queen's Park | 39 | 10 | 4 | 6 | 34 | 32 | 2 | 6 | 11 | 18 | 44 | 12 | 10 | 17 | 52 | 76 | 34 | -24 |
| 12 | Arbroath | 39 | 6 | 8 | 5 | 24 | 28 | 6 | 1 | 13 | 18 | 39 | 12 | 9 | 18 | 42 | 67 | 33 | -25 |
| 13 | Albion Rovers | 39 | 3 | 5 | 12 | 18 | 33 | 4 | 5 | 10 | 19 | 33 | 7 | 10 | 22 | 37 | 66 | 24 | -29 |
| 14 | Cowdenbeath | 39 | 1 | 4 | 15 | 19 | 39 | 5 | 4 | 10 | 21 | 33 | 6 | 8 | 25 | 40 | 72 | 20 | -32 |

| Stranraer were promoted to the new Division One while the bottom eight clubs formed a new Division Three with the addition of Caledonian Thistle and Ross County. |
